About The Position
We are looking for an experienced lawyer with 5+ years of expertise in contract management including but not limited to review, negotiate, redline various types of contracts and experienced in data protection laws to ensure compliance with global and regional privacy regulations, including GDPR and the India Digital Data Privacy Bill.
Key Responsibilities
Work closely with legal, compliance, IT, and security teams to manage data privacy initiatives. Lead the implementation of privacy policies and risk mitigation strategies. Independently draft, review and negotiate DPAs, Standard contractual clauses and other relevant data protection documents. Drafting, review, negotiation, and finalization of business agreements (vendor contracts, NDA, MOUs, Marketing agreements, collaboration agreements, admin agreements, employment contracts, business support agreements, loan agreements etc.) lease deeds, affidavits, POA and all forms of legal arrangements. Ensure contracts align with legal standards and company policies. Provide analysis of contractual obligations and risks associated in a given contract.
Program Management
Oversee the company’s global privacy program, ensuring adherence to privacy laws and internal policies. Lead the execution of the India Digital Data Privacy Bill.
Compliance Monitoring
Establish frameworks for ongoing monitoring of privacy compliance including but not limited to setting up end to end framework for Controller and Processor in an organization. Review and update privacy policies regularly, ensuring compliance with audits and regulations.
Incident Response
Lead responses to data breaches, privacy complaints, and access requests. Assist with data breach notification and remediation processes.
Training and Awareness
Conduct privacy awareness programs and training for employees from time to time.
Internal Audit
Plan and execute internal audits to assess operational efficiency. Identify areas for process improvement and risk mitigation. Produce comprehensive audit reports with actionable recommendations.
Legal Consultation
Advise on privacy laws and implement actionable guidelines across jurisdictions.
Skills & Qualifications
Law degree with 5+ years of experience in contract reviewing and data privacy and regulatory compliance. Expertise in GDPR, CCPA, India Digital Data Privacy Bill, and other relevant data protection laws. Strong communication, program management, and incident response skills. Ability to monitor privacy trends and adapt policies accordingly.
